Understanding Heart Failure: Heart failure is a chronic condition where the heart is unable to pump enough blood to meet the body's needs. It can be classified into two types: heart failure with reduced ejection fraction (HFREF) and heart failure with preserved ejection fraction (HFPEF). HFREF occurs when the heart muscle weakens and cannot effectively contract, leading to low pumping capacity. This condition affects millions of individuals worldwide, causing debilitating symptoms and reducing quality of life. Causes of Heart Failure: 1. Coronary Artery Disease: The leading cause of HFREF is coronary artery disease, where plaque buildup narrows the arteries supplying blood to the heart muscle. This restricts blood flow and causes damage to the heart muscle over time. 2. High Blood Pressure: Prolonged high blood pressure can put excessive strain on the heart, leading to its weakening and eventual failure. 3. Heart Attack: A heart attack occurs when there is a sudden blockage of blood flow to the heart, often resulting from a blood clot. A heart attack can cause irreversible damage to the heart muscle, increasing the risk of heart failure. 4. Diabetes: Uncontrolled diabetes can damage blood vessels and nerves, negatively impacting the heart's ability to function properly. Risks and Prevention: Several factors increase the risk of developing HFREF. These include age, family history of heart disease, smoking, sedentary lifestyle, obesity, and certain medical conditions such as sleep apnea. Fortunately, many of these risks can be reduced or eliminated through lifestyle modifications and regular monitoring. Role of Workplace Health Promotion Networks: 1. Education and Awareness: Workplace health promotion networks can organize informational sessions to educate employees about heart failure causes, risks, and prevention strategies. Providing employees with knowledge empowers them to make informed decisions about their health. 2. Wellness Programs: Implementing wellness programs such as exercise classes, nutrition workshops, and stress management sessions can promote regular physical activity, healthy eating habits, and stress reduction. These interventions contribute to preventing heart disease and reducing the risk of heart failure. 3. Health Assessments: Regular health assessments and screenings can identify potential risk factors, enabling early detection and intervention. Workplace health promotion networks can facilitate access to cardiovascular screenings, ensuring employees receive necessary care. 4. Support and Counseling: Offering resources like counseling services can provide emotional support for those at risk or already experiencing heart failure.
